Subject: Project Ashdell — Delay Update

Exec team: Ashdell slips another six weeks. Root cause: integration testing failures on the Renlow module. Revised go-live is early Q4. Finance impact: 180K additional contractor spend, absorbed within contingency. No change to vendor commitments. Weekly status resumes Monday under Tomas Brevik. The confidential recovery plan is set out immediately below.

board note of tadup-hadug: Only 35 of the 418 pilot accounts renewed Wenax, so a churn review is set for April 16. Istysix Logistics is in early talks to buy Gilysix Works for about $414.8 million.

Q2 review complete. Drennick Works is running at 94% utilisation; overtime spend up 18% quarter-on-quarter. Options assessed: third shift, outsourcing to Pelham Fabrication, or a new line. Third shift wins on payback — under fourteen months. Outsourcing fails on margin; new line deferred pending demand confirmation. Sales leads: do not commit delivery dates beyond ten weeks until the shift is staffed. Budget impact absorbed within existing opex. Decision memo circulates next week. The restricted planning note follows immediately below.

internal memo for kaduf-baduf: Only 35 of the 378 pilot accounts renewed Holir, so a churn review is set for June 11. Eliielax Group is in early talks to buy Silaelix Group for about $142.1 million.

## Q3 Regional Sales Review — Managers Only

Northvale region beat target by 6%; Carrow Basin missed by 11%. Dalen Orth attributes the shortfall to delayed Stratix 4 stock. Actions: reallocate two reps from Northvale, tighten pipeline reporting, weekly forecasts from all leads starting Monday. Harwick territory review deferred to next cycle. Full figures are in the shared tracker. The confidential directive on next quarter's plans follows below.

board note of kageg-bahof: The renewal with Holwynax Holdings closes at $2 million a year, 5 percent below the last contract. Project Ulaath slips by two quarters because of the supplier delay.

**Ticket: Config drift in Auditpane viewer (prod vs. staging)**

For the release manager: the Auditpane audit-log viewer in production is running with a retention window and page-size limit that diverge from what staging validated, which explains the truncated results reported last sprint. Please hold the Friday release until production is reconciled to the approved values listed below.

service settings:
[casax]
port = 6379
team = rusir
host = casax.zemvarhq.corp
region = outer-4
access_code = ac_9808ce
timeout_ms = 1500